The Jack Youngblood of the 400m??

I have mentioned in anatomy class many times that the fibula is a non-weight bearing bone. Jack Youngblood played the entire 1979 playoffs including the Super Bowl and the useless Pro Bowl on a broken left fibula. I cannot imagine the pain involved with this.

Manteo Mitchell of the USA 4 x 400 team may have surpassed this amazing feat in the 2012 London Olympics. While Jack Youngblood was able to be taped and probably take painkillers in preparation for the games, Manteo broke his leg during the race. He completed his leg (another 200 m) on the broken fibula.
